import { VersionedTransaction } from "@solana/web3.js"; import { PublicKey } from "@solana/web3.js"; import { GibworkCreateTaskReponse, SolanaAgentKit } from "../index"; /** * Create an new task on Gibwork * @param agent SolanaAgentKit instance * @param title Title of the task * @param content Description of the task * @param requirements Requirements to complete the task * @param tags List of tags associated with the task * @param payer Payer address for the task (default: agent wallet address) * @param tokenMintAddress Token mint address for payment * @param tokenAmount Payment amount for the task * @returns Object containing task creation transaction and generated taskId */ export async function create_gibwork_task( agent: SolanaAgentKit, title: string, content: string, requirements: string, tags: string[], tokenMintAddress: PublicKey, tokenAmount: number, payer?: PublicKey, ): Promise { try { const apiResponse = await fetch( "https://api2.gib.work/tasks/public/transaction", { method: "POST", headers: { "Content-Type": "application/json", }, body: JSON.stringify({ title: title, content: content, requirements: requirements, tags: tags, payer: payer?.toBase58() || agent.wallet.publicKey.toBase58(), token: { mintAddress: tokenMintAddress.toBase58(), amount: tokenAmount, }, }), }, ); const responseData = await apiResponse.json(); if (!responseData.taskId && !responseData.serializedTransaction) { throw new Error(`${responseData.message}`); } const serializedTransaction = Buffer.from( responseData.serializedTransaction, "base64", ); const tx = VersionedTransaction.deserialize(serializedTransaction); tx.sign([agent.wallet]); const signature = await agent.connection.sendTransaction(tx, { preflightCommitment: "confirmed", maxRetries: 3, }); const latestBlockhash = await agent.connection.getLatestBlockhash(); await agent.connection.confirmTransaction({ signature, blockhash: latestBlockhash.blockhash, lastValidBlockHeight: latestBlockhash.lastValidBlockHeight, }); return { status: "success", taskId: responseData.taskId, signature: signature, }; } catch (err: any) { throw new Error(`${err.message}`); } }
